Madraladpur is a Rural village located in Kalpi, Jalaun, Uttar-pradesh.

The total population of Madraladpur is 1,061.

Madraladpur village comprises 190 households.

The literacy rate in Madraladpur is 60.3%. Among the literate population of 524, there are 325 literate males and 199 literate females.

In Madraladpur, there are 575 males and 486 females, with a sex ratio of 845 females per 1000 males.

There are 192 children (18.1% of population), comprising 118 boys and 74 girls.

The total number of workers in Madraladpur is 511, with 109 main workers and 402 marginal workers.

In Madraladpur, there are 7 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(4 males, 3 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Madraladpur is located in Uttar-pradesh state, Jalaun district, and falls under Kalpi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 151580 and LGD code is 151580.
